Error when trying to open Infopath form with SharePoint 2013.

I have a user that recieves the following error every time she tries to access a link to an Infopath form in SharePoint 2013.

"The specified form template could not be found, or is not compatible with rendering in the browser. It might need to be republished as a browser-enable form.

Click Try again to attempt to load the form again. If this error persists, contact the support team for the Web site.

Click Close to exit this message."

 She has Infopath 2010 on her PC and she was able to open the same forms yesterday.

Any ideas?

A few suggestions;

Ensure user is using the 32 bit version of IE, and hasn't clicked the x64 version by mistake

Check if anyone changed the form since yesterday

Try any of the following:
•      In IE, go to options > connections > Lan settings, turn of "Automatically detect settings"
•      Make your SP site is a Trusted Site in IE
•      Add SP to the Trusted Locations in Office
•      Turn off all the Protected View options in the Office Trust Center
•      Delete the Office cache file:
c:\Users\\AppData\Local\Microsoft\Office\14.0\OfficeFileCache


And finally of course, upgrade her to Infopath 2013...
